Human activities significantly impact coastline shipping through pollution, habitat destruction, and increased maritime traffic. Industrial runoff and urban waste can contaminate coastal waters, affecting marine life and potentially disrupting shipping routes. Additionally, coastal development and land reclamation can alter natural shorelines, leading to changes in currents and sediment patterns that may affect navigation. Moreover, increased shipping traffic raises the risk of accidents and environmental hazards, further complicating maritime operations.
